Subject: Heads up — PickFlow key rotation this Friday

Hi plugin folks,

We're rotating credentials for the PickFlow optimizer API at the end of this week. Nothing dramatic — routine hygiene after our quarterly audit. Your existing keys for the public endpoints stay valid, so most of you can ignore this entirely.

If your plugin calls the internal route-scoring service (the one behind the Harborline gateway), you'll need the new key before Friday. Swap it in your config and restart.

Here's the new internal key:

gateway credential: kto23_LX9A4ys6i4nzHtpOLNLodKK

Handover Note — Badge Migration, Week 2

Hi Tomas, quick rundown before you take over. The Meridex reader swap is done on floors 1–3; floor 4 is scheduled for Thursday. Contractor badges are in the grey tray, already sorted. Only snag: the server room door still runs on the old system, so use the legacy code below.

turnstile pass: bdg-QZV-3

## Notification Fan-out Backpressure

The Pexlin notifier fans out alerts to downstream channels via a bounded queue. When the queue fills, FANOUT_SHED_MODE controls whether we drop low-priority events or block producers. Contractors should keep FANOUT_QUEUE_MAX at 5000 in staging. The worker also authenticates to the Quellhaven broker, so your env file must include the broker credential on the next line.

secret setting of hawep-yahig: LEDGER_TOKEN29=41b5d6315371c92885eaeb077fb63

Finance Review — Large-Deal Discount Policy. Discounts above 15% on deals exceeding threshold now require sign-off from the pricing committee, not regional leads. Q2 data shows margin erosion on the Kestrane line from unchecked concessions. New tiers take effect immediately; exceptions expire month-end. Heads of department should brief their sales managers this week. The connection to forthcoming plans is stated below.

management briefing: Goroxix Systems is in early talks to buy Kelethek Holdings for about $118.0 million. The Sileth launch date is February 25, and nothing goes to the press before then. Legal wants the Pelokox Logistics term sheet withdrawn before December 14.